Radical Prostatectomy (Surgery)

Tips and advice for any bladder or bowel side effects of treatment

I’m convinced that regular kegel exercises are a big help to overcome incontinence

Tips and advice for any sexual side effects of treatment

I am using a combination of vacuum pump and viagra tablets and have recently started noticing an improvement

How this treatment impacted my life the most

The worst part for me was having to have the catheter in for 3 weeks And the subsequent incontinance, I found regular exercise helped enormously, I’ve been walking daily, playing badminton a couple of times a week (both of these as soon as the catheter was removed) and I started cycling 12 weeks after the operation (after advice from my surgeon)

If I had to do it all over again, would I choose the same treatment?

Yes

Why did I give this answer?

Even though when the prostate was examined it showed a “positive margin” I have had 2 subsequent psa tests with readings of <0.01. But I understand that radiotherapy could still be an option for me if it were to be needed, whereas if I had radiotherapy treatment to start with, a prostatectomy would be difficult if the cancer returned.
